58 www.thejewelrybook.com First of all, Is it important to let everyone know that De Hago manufactures their jewelry pieces in their New York studios. Can you tell how this makes your designs unique? The ability to control every detail results in the very best quality and workman- ship that truly represents our vision. The importance of the very fi nest craftsman- ship right in the heart of New York City makes our unique pieces stand out. What can we expect to see from DeHago this year at the Las Vegas shows? We will be presenting the vibrant new 'Power of Color' jewelry, featuring our nature and energy inspired diamond collections as well as our latest exciting Bridal designs. We also will be pre- senting spectacular 3-carat on up to 6-carat diamond center stones to fi ll that demand for bigger size center stones. Your 'Power of Color' designs combines rubies, sapphires and emeralds. Tell us a little bit about these designs. Our appreciation for the emotional beauty and freshness of these rich colors becomes evident with our signature jewelry. The deep rich hues of rubies, sapphires, and emeralds surrounded by brilliant diamonds and set in platinum gives an unparalleled sophistication to each and every one of our designs. We want our clients to experience the delight of our 'Power of Color' collections. Stackable rings seem to be a favorite design group, tell us about these. That is our 'Bands of Love' collections. These wedding bands and engagement rings feature diamonds set in beautifull elegant designs. It's very chic and trendy, but will always be the treasured symbols of loving relationships.
